Currently we are seeking a full-time, BC / BE Palliative Medicine physician to join our team in San Francisco, CA :

Full-time annual salary range is $295,889 to $305,040 plus additional potential incentives of $22,235

  • . Reduced schedules with pro-rated compensation may be available.
  • Additional incentive opportunities are available based on geographic location, experience and include potential premium pay.

  • TPMG is one of the largest medical groups in the nation with over 10,000 physicians, 21 medical centers, numerous clinics throughout Northern and Central California and an over 80-year tradition of providing quality medical care.
